Output 18a671e60117eafa44016432e94c318b49fc7d1e5b4033f8f0babbe247fe75ca:1

value
20241561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6242fddf4e274cc14bb2b1a0adbb876ce4bf5dc9 OP_EQUAL
address
3AeaQ1NgY5Bsj2ozFxFW8pJnEbhup8D9N7
transaction
18a671e60117eafa44016432e94c318b49fc7d1e5b4033f8f0babbe247fe75ca
confirmations
362608
spent
true